GRANTHAM, Pa - Down 6-2 in the seventh inning, the Penn State Abington baseball team generated a late comeback, topping Messiah College 9-8 on Tuesday afternoon.
Senior
Tom Ditro (Philadelphia, Pa) led the Nittany Lions offense going 2-of-4 with two runs and three RBIs, including a go-ahead RBI double in the eighth inning.
Ditro showed his versatility on the mound, going six innings with eight strikeouts.
Greg Mugnier (Abington, Pa) got his second win of the season for Abington, as he pitched the final three innings.
The Falcons jumped out in front with five runs in the first four innings, but Abington chipped away at Messiah's lead down 6-2 in the sixth inning.
Shaky pitching in the seventh inning gave the Nittany Lions two runs on walked in batters, cutting the Falcons lead to 6-4. An error by the pitcher allowed another two runs to score which tied the game.
The Nittany Lions broke the stalemate on Ditro's double and
Pat Fitzgerald added another run to the board with an RBI single to left center field.
Abington will host a critical conference doubleheader when they face Gallaudet Saturday afternoon at 1:00 p.m.
